Nikolai Sergeyevich Golitsyn created his major work "Universal Military History" during his professorial and teaching activities at the Imperial Military Academy, where he headed the department of strategy and military history. Golitsyn's work became the first in Russia and one...
of the first in Europe to attempt a complete and systematic exposition of universal military history. The work provides a complete and detailed overview of the wars and campaigns of great commanders, military-historical events in necessary connection with the contemporary history of the author: political, military art, the art and science of warfare, and military literature. Subsequently, the work was translated into German, and its author was elected a member of the Swedish Academy of Military Sciences.
The book has not been reissued since its first publication. This edition publishes the first part of the work - "Ancient World", devoted to the analysis of the central military conflicts of antiquity up to the wars of the Roman Empire.
